1. Begin Early

If your event is a large event you should realistically begin planning it four to six weeks beforehand. Smaller events need at least one month to strategy. To maintain the final run up to this event flowing easily, try to make sure that all vendor contracts have been completed a few weeks before the occasion.

2. Always remain Flexible

On the course of planning case, things are going to change. Whether it’s event times, locations or even the type of event you’re hosting, you need to ensure that you’re adaptable and can meet the shifting demands.

3Negotiate

Despite what many vendors will let you know, everything is negotiable. Remember that with each event there will be unforeseen costs, so try to pay off as low a cost as possible. Determine your budget before fulfilling a vendor, and offer to cover 5-10% lower than this figure. Your vendor may put up a struggle, but finally they want to win your business.

4. Assign Responsibilities

Break up the various elements of the occasion into sections (e.g. enrollment, catering, transport), and assign a section to every member of your group. Since they are solely responsible for their own section they’ll be much more clued into small detail varies.

5. Share status updates through the cloud

With the cloud comes many benefits, and collaborating with your staff couldn’t be easier. In order to keep everyone on the same page, make a fundamental manual or document that details everything to do with the event, such as vendor contracts, attendee info, and the floor plan. With a shared record everyone is able to refer back to it whenever they are uncertain, and your entire team can see if something is out of place.

6. Have a Backup Plan For Your NWI Event

It is rare that an event is actually pulled off without at least one issue, an item may not turn an important person might arrive late. Assess the most important assets that your event will have, and create a backup plan for every . If a number of problems emerge later on, triage them and decide whether an alternative could be found, or if it should be cut completely from the occasion.

8. Be Photogenic 

Pictures paint a thousand words, and posting favorable photographs on the internet is a superb way to demonstrate the achievement of your event. In case you’ve got the budget hire a professional photographer, they will be more clued into the sorts of photographs which are needed and will approach you for particulars. Ask for a number of shots to ensure you cover all bases like a snap of the full room, photos of occasion branding, and a lot of photos of attendees enjoying themselves.

9. Get Online!!

An occasion is the best way to up your social media presence. Create a custom hashtag to your event on Twitter and encourage your followers to converse about it. Likewise make an event on Facebook, and encourage your visitors to tag the occasion in related posts. Upload your photos once the event is over and actively encourage users to label themselves.

10. Don’t forget to follow-up

Once the event is finished, many organizers fall into a common pitfall — taking a break. While the logistics could possibly be done it’s important to be proactive in following up with attendees, be it over email or on social networking, to show the achievement of this function.
